- This week we're exploring more with sublimation! This week we're going to show you two methods to sublimate on dark colored t-shirts! We love the option of printing our own images and infusing them into the t-shirts with a cotton blend, but what if you wanted to sublimate on 100% cotton or even dark fabrics?! We're going to show you an amazing bleach method that super precise and second option using Siser's Easy Subli HTV & Mask which is super easy! Come watch us #doitbuilditmakeit!

Great video thank you for doing this video👍❤😊
Great question, for bleaching & sublimating you want close to a 50/50 cotton/polyester blend. Full polyester will not bleach.
